Knife crime sentencing quarterly brief
The publication provides early indications of trends and is planned as a temporary release to cover the life and impact of the Tackling Knives Action Programme, which was launched to focus resources on rapid, intensive work in a number of areas of England and Wales to tackle knife crime.
The first two bulletins (October to December 2008 and January to March 2009) provide statistics on Phase I of the Tackling Knives Action Programme, which was launched in June 2008 and covered 10 police areas.
Phase II started in April 2009 and now covers 16 police force areas. Statistics on Phase II are provided in bulletins from April to June 2009 onwards.
The bulletin is released by the Ministry of Justice and produced in accordance with arrangements approved by the UK Statistics Authority.

The bulletin is produced and handled by the ministry's analytical professionals and production staff. Pre-release access of up to 24 hours is granted to the following persons:
Ministry of Justice: Secretary of State; Minister of State; Under Secretary of State; Head of Sentencing Policy and Penalties Unit; Head of the Community Sentences and Interventions team in Joint Youth Justice Unit; Head of Community Skills and Employment Unit; Head of Justice Team – Office for Criminal Justice Reform; Chief Press Officer, Senior Press Officer and Press Officer from Criminal Justice Desk; Special Advisers
Home Office: Home Secretary, Minister of State for Policing, Crime and Security; Parliamentary Under Secretary of State for Crime Reduction; Head of Violent Crime Unit; Head of Public Space Violence Team; Head of Tackling Knives Action Programme (TKAP); Operational Head of TKAP; Principal Research Officer, Violence and Alcohol, Research and Analysis Unit; Senior Research Officer, Violence and Alcohol, Research and Analysis Unit; Chief Press Officer, Senior Press Officer, and Press Officer - Crime and Community Safety; Special Advisers
Prime Minister's Delivery Unit: Principal Analyst
